I am composing a theme that could be a Danzón.

What is the time signature used for danzón ?

2/4 ?

In the Orquesta, we write it in 4/4, with the basic subdivision of the beat being eighth notes. In other words, clave is two measures in 4/4. All the charts and educational materials I've seen use this convention (e.g., the Latin Real Book, Rebeca Mauleon's books, etc.).

You could write it in 2/4 if you wanted. Some older Cuban music I've seen, like the Danzas Cubanas of Ignacio Cervantes, were written in 2/4, with sixteenth note subdivisions.

At a workshop I once saw Chucho Valdes write clave as one measure of 4/4, also using a sixteenth-note subdivision. Some Cubans may use this convention, but I've never seen it in any bands I've worked with.
